This thesis, Impressive Mastermind, examines notions of privacy and the law, particularly with regard to the USA Patriot Act implemented following the events of 9/11. The author/artist believes that numerous freedoms related to personal privacy, especially those rights protected by the Fourth Amendment, were diminished in order to ostensibly seek out potential terrorists. Through the vehicle of a theatrical dance performance, Impressive Mastermind investigates these privacy issues on a public and personal level and also asks the audience to question their own views on government policies regarding personal privacy, including illegal search and seizure. Drawing on the previous work of other intervention artists, this thesis explores the realm of public intervention. Moving away from the usual spectacle of traditional theater, this multi-dimensional piece explores an experiential examination of how the public relates to what is real and what is considered performative.

The purpose of my creative research was to analyze my choreographic process and answer the research question: how will implementing somatic principles impact my choreographic process? In determining the impact I analyzed the use of choreographic approaches that bring proprioceptive awareness to interdisciplinary somatic themes of bodily systems, sensing, connectivity, initiation and sequencing. These somatic themes were utilized in movement invention and exploration as well as the structuring and performance of my choreography. Additionally, the research involved clarifying my role as a choreographer and my relationship to the dancers in my work. My creative research occurred in three choreographic phases and resulted in the production of B.O.D.I.E.S performed in three consecutive sections titled Discovery, Exploration, and Identity November 5-7, 2010. B.O.D.I.E.S demonstrates how somatics will lead to greater movement possibilities and dynamic range to explore in the craft of dance making.

Bisexuality is a unique kind of sexual identity, as a gray area between heterosexuality and homosexuality. The piece You made up the Story and I Played with all the Parts explores bisexuality as a lived artistic experience based on my sexual journey within a society that advocates heterosexuality. The piece includes movement phrases and text derived from conversations with intimate partners, characters based on former partners, storytelling, a 1950s-style sex education video parody, and audience participation via dialogue. The creation of movement and dialogue manipulated heteronormative social stigmas into a canny social acceptance of bisexuality. The multifaceted nature of the piece provokes viewers to consider how sexuality is constructed socially through my own interpretation. As a result, the work suggests that bisexuality is a legitimate sexual identity and represents a culture within American society.

This dissertation is focused on building scalable Attribute Based Security Systems (ABSS), including efficient and privacy-preserving attribute based encryption schemes and applications to group communications and cloud computing. First of all, a Constant Ciphertext Policy Attribute Based Encryption (CCP-ABE) is proposed. Existing Attribute Based Encryption (ABE) schemes usually incur large, linearly increasing ciphertext. The proposed CCP-ABE dramatically reduces the ciphertext to small, constant size. This is the first existing ABE scheme that achieves constant ciphertext size. Also, the proposed CCP-ABE scheme is fully collusion-resistant such that users can not combine their attributes to elevate their decryption capacity. Next step, efficient ABE schemes are applied to construct optimal group communication schemes and broadcast encryption schemes. An attribute based Optimal Group Key (OGK) management scheme that attains communication-storage optimality without collusion vulnerability is presented. Then, a novel broadcast encryption model: Attribute Based Broadcast Encryption (ABBE) is introduced, which exploits the many-to-many nature of attributes to dramatically reduce the storage complexity from linear to logarithm and enable expressive attribute based access policies. The privacy issues are also considered and addressed in ABSS. Firstly, a hidden policy based ABE schemes is proposed to protect receivers' privacy by hiding the access policy. Secondly,a new concept: Gradual Identity Exposure (GIE) is introduced to address the restrictions of hidden policy based ABE schemes. GIE's approach is to reveal the receivers' information gradually by allowing ciphertext recipients to decrypt the message using their possessed attributes one-by-one. If the receiver does not possess one attribute in this procedure, the rest of attributes are still hidden. Compared to hidden-policy based solutions, GIE provides significant performance improvement in terms of reducing both computation and communication overhead. Last but not least, ABSS are incorporated into the mobile cloud computing scenarios. In the proposed secure mobile cloud data management framework, the light weight mobile devices can securely outsource expensive ABE operations and data storage to untrusted cloud service providers. The reported scheme includes two components: (1) a Cloud-Assisted Attribute-Based Encryption/Decryption (CA-ABE) scheme and (2) An Attribute-Based Data Storage (ABDS) scheme that achieves information theoretical optimality.

Embodied Continuity documents the methodology of Entangled/Embraced, a dance performance piece presented December, 2011 and created as an artistic translation of research conducted January-May, 2011 in the states of Karnataka and Kerala, South India. Focused on the sciences of Ayurveda, Kalaripayattu and yoga, this research stems from an interest in body-mind connectivity, body-mind-environment continuity, embodied epistemology and the implications of ethnography within artistic practice. The document begins with a theoretical grounding covering established research on theories of embodiment; ethnographic methodologies framing research conducted in South India including sensory ethnography, performance ethnography and autoethnography; and an explanation of the sciences of Ayurveda, Kalaripayattu and yoga with a descriptive slant that emphasizes concepts of embodiment and body-mind-environment continuity uniquely inherent to these sciences. Following the theoretical grounding, the document provides an account of methods used in translating theoretical concepts and experiences emerging from research in India into the creation of the Entangled/Embraced dance work. Using dancer and audience member participation to inspire emergent meanings and maintain ethnographic consciousness, Embodied Continuity demonstrates how concepts inspiring research interests, along with ideas emerging from within research experiences, in addition to philosophical standpoints embedded in the ethnographic methodologies chosen to conduct research, weave into the entire project of Entangled/Embraced to unite the phases of research and performance, ethnography and artistry.

In modern healthcare environments, there is a strong need to create an infrastructure that reduces time-consuming efforts and costly operations to obtain a patient's complete medical record and uniformly integrates this heterogeneous collection of medical data to deliver it to the healthcare professionals. As a result, healthcare providers are more willing to shift their electronic medical record (EMR) systems to clouds that can remove the geographical distance barriers among providers and patient. Even though cloud-based EMRs have received considerable attention since it would help achieve lower operational cost and better interoperability with other healthcare providers, the adoption of security-aware cloud systems has become an extremely important prerequisite for bringing interoperability and efficient management to the healthcare industry. Since a shared electronic health record (EHR) essentially represents a virtualized aggregation of distributed clinical records from multiple healthcare providers, sharing of such integrated EHRs may comply with various authorization policies from these data providers. In this work, we focus on the authorized and selective sharing of EHRs among several parties with different duties and objectives that satisfies access control and compliance issues in healthcare cloud computing environments. We present a secure medical data sharing framework to support selective sharing of composite EHRs aggregated from various healthcare providers and compliance of HIPAA regulations. Our approach also ensures that privacy concerns need to be accommodated for processing access requests to patients' healthcare information. To realize our proposed approach, we design and implement a cloud-based EHRs sharing system. In addition, we describe case studies and evaluation results to demonstrate the effectiveness and efficiency of our approach.

Access control is one of the most fundamental security mechanisms used in the design and management of modern information systems. However, there still exists an open question on how formal access control models can be automatically analyzed and fully realized in secure system development. Furthermore, specifying and managing access control policies are often error-prone due to the lack of effective analysis mechanisms and tools. In this dissertation, I present an Assurance Management Framework (AMF) that is designed to cope with various assurance management requirements from both access control system development and policy-based computing. On one hand, the AMF framework facilitates comprehensive analysis and thorough realization of formal access control models in secure system development. I demonstrate how this method can be applied to build role-based access control systems by adopting the NIST/ANSI RBAC standard as an underlying security model. On the other hand, the AMF framework ensures the correctness of access control policies in policy-based computing through automated reasoning techniques and anomaly management mechanisms. A systematic method is presented to formulate XACML in Answer Set Programming (ASP) that allows users to leverage off-the-shelf ASP solvers for a variety of analysis services. In addition, I introduce a novel anomaly management mechanism, along with a grid-based visualization approach, which enables systematic and effective detection and resolution of policy anomalies. I further evaluate the AMF framework through modeling and analyzing multiparty access control in Online Social Networks (OSNs). A MultiParty Access Control (MPAC) model is formulated to capture the essence of multiparty authorization requirements in OSNs. In particular, I show how AMF can be applied to OSNs for identifying and resolving privacy conflicts, and representing and reasoning about MPAC model and policy. To demonstrate the feasibility of the proposed methodology, a suite of proof-of-concept prototype systems is implemented as well.

Physical activity has been shown to be effective in primary and secondary prevention of chronic diseases such as diabetes, cancer and cardiovascular disease (Warburton, Nicol & Bredin, 2006). Women tend to be much less active than males and are henceforth at a greater risk for developing these conditions (Biddle & Mutrie, 2008). This study addresses what impact type of physical activity in adolescence has on adult physical activity levels in the female population. Specifically, the study focuses on coordination and performance activities in adolescence, and how adult physical activity levels compare to both sedentary adolescents and adolescent endurance and ball sport athletes. Ninety-six female participants that were ages 20-29 (N=53) and 30-39 (N=43) were asked to fill out a survey about their adolescent activity levels and their current activity levels. Those participants who identified as participating in coordination and performance activity (N=43) were compared to those who were sedentary (N=14) and then further compared to those who engaged in other types of adolescent activity (N=39). It was determined that coordination and performance activities during adolescence did have a significant effect on frequency of female adult physical activity when compared to their sedentary counterparts (p=0.015). Adolescent endurance and ball sport athletes did tend to have a greater frequency of current activity in adulthood than those involved in coordination and performance activities, which was attributed to a greater frequency of practice per week in those sports. In conclusion, introducing a frequent amount of physical activity the female adolescent enjoys increases their likelihood of frequently engaging in physical activity as an adult.

ABSTRACT Moving beyond Form: Communicating Identity through Dance chronicles the journey of investigating my personal creative process in dance. This was a search for strategies to empower myself creatively, enabling me to move beyond the limitations of a prescribed form or style of dance and communicate ideas that were relevant to me. But on a deeper level, it was an exploration of my capacity to self-define through movement. The challenge led me to graduate school, international study with world-renowned choreographers and to the development of a holistic creative practice, Movement to Meaning. The aim of this creative practice is to express internal awareness through movement, thereby enabling the mover to dance from an internal reference point. In my research, I utilized Movement to Meaning to re-contextualize Sandia, a traditional-based dance that is indigenous to various Mande subgroups in West Africa. This project culminated in a choreographic presentation, Ten For Every Thousand, which was performed in October 2010 at the Nelson Fine Arts Center at Arizona State University in Tempe, Arizona.
